你查询的IP:[159.226.202.33]  地理位置:中国–北京–北京科技网

最新查询61.240.58.195 203.95.8.135 59.192.65.149 125.210.42.92 119.128.156.9 211.64.2.45 125.32.49.209 119.41.116.54 202.226.110.152 159.226.202.33 222.64.249.83 61.45.128.252 210.25.1.94 119.41.244.231 210.15.128.59 221.196.198.78 118.184.167.152 203.192.195.169 202.91.128.36 122.200.64.197 123.242.146.184 203.209.224.36 202.91.29.18 120.137.38.65 58.14.97.204 121.56.68.4 125.61.128.239 202.38.140.0 202.127.160.22 117.40.179.138 221.129.217.136